黑狐家游戏

加密技术主要包括,加密技术包括什么体系类型

欧气 4 0

标题:《探索加密技术的多元体系类型》

在当今数字化时代,信息安全至关重要,而加密技术则是保障信息安全的核心手段之一,加密技术主要包括对称加密、非对称加密、哈希算法、数字签名等多种体系类型,每种类型都有其独特的特点和应用场景。

一、对称加密体系

对称加密是一种传统的加密技术,它使用相同的密钥进行加密和解密,在对称加密体系中,加密和解密的过程非常快速,因此适用于对大量数据进行加密,常见的对称加密算法包括 AES(Advanced Encryption Standard,高级加密标准)、DES(Data Encryption Standard,数据加密标准)等。

AES 是目前应用最广泛的对称加密算法之一,它具有以下优点:

1、安全性高:AES 算法经过了严格的安全性评估,被认为是一种非常安全的加密算法。

2、密钥长度灵活:AES 算法支持 128 位、192 位和 256 位三种密钥长度,可以根据实际需求选择合适的密钥长度。

3、加密和解密速度快:AES 算法的加密和解密速度非常快,适用于对大量数据进行加密。

二、非对称加密体系

非对称加密是一种相对较新的加密技术,它使用一对密钥进行加密和解密,其中一个密钥是公开的,另一个密钥是私有的,在非对称加密体系中,加密和解密的过程相对复杂,因此适用于对少量重要数据进行加密,常见的非对称加密算法包括 RSA(Rivest-Shamir-Adleman,RSA 算法)、DSA(Digital Signature Algorithm,数字签名算法)等。

RSA 是目前应用最广泛的非对称加密算法之一,它具有以下优点:

1、安全性高:RSA 算法经过了严格的安全性评估,被认为是一种非常安全的加密算法。

2、密钥长度灵活:RSA 算法支持 512 位、1024 位和 2048 位三种密钥长度,可以根据实际需求选择合适的密钥长度。

3、加密和解密速度慢:RSA 算法的加密和解密速度相对较慢,不适用于对大量数据进行加密。

三、哈希算法体系

哈希算法是一种单向加密算法,它将任意长度的输入数据转换为固定长度的输出数据,并且输出数据具有唯一性,哈希算法常用于数据完整性校验、数字签名等领域,常见的哈希算法包括 MD5(Message Digest Algorithm 5,MD5 算法)、SHA-1(Secure Hash Algorithm 1,SHA-1 算法)等。

MD5 是一种常用的哈希算法,它具有以下优点:

1、安全性高:MD5 算法经过了广泛的应用和研究,被认为是一种相对安全的哈希算法。

2、输出长度固定:MD5 算法的输出长度为 128 位,固定不变。

3、计算速度快:MD5 算法的计算速度非常快,适用于对大量数据进行哈希计算。

四、数字签名体系

数字签名是一种基于非对称加密技术的认证技术,它可以确保数据的完整性和真实性,数字签名的过程包括生成数字签名、验证数字签名等步骤,在数字签名的过程中,发送方使用自己的私钥对数据进行加密,生成数字签名,接收方使用发送方的公钥对数字签名进行解密,验证数据的完整性和真实性。

数字签名具有以下优点:

1、安全性高:数字签名基于非对称加密技术,具有很高的安全性。

2、不可否认性:数字签名可以确保发送方无法否认自己发送过数据,具有不可否认性。

3、完整性验证:数字签名可以确保数据在传输过程中没有被篡改,具有完整性验证功能。

五、加密技术的应用场景

加密技术在各个领域都有广泛的应用,以下是一些常见的应用场景:

1、电子商务:在电子商务中,加密技术可以确保交易双方的身份认证和数据传输的安全性。

2、金融领域:在金融领域,加密技术可以确保客户的账户信息和交易数据的安全性。

3、网络安全:在网络安全中,加密技术可以保护网络中的数据和通信安全。

4、移动设备:在移动设备中,加密技术可以保护用户的隐私和数据安全。

六、总结

加密技术是保障信息安全的核心手段之一,它包括对称加密、非对称加密、哈希算法、数字签名等多种体系类型,每种类型都有其独特的特点和应用场景,在实际应用中需要根据具体需求选择合适的加密技术,随着信息技术的不断发展,加密技术也在不断演进和完善,未来加密技术将在更多领域得到广泛应用。

标签: #加密技术 #体系类型 #包括内容 #技术类型

黑狐家游戏
  • 评论列表

留言评论